#36 Enjoy Your Local Parks, scrapbook, 1984

Milton Keynes was designed with green space as a priority and today there are about 5000 acres of parkland, forest and waterways within the city’s limits. It is hardly surprising that in 1984 the Milton Keynes Development Corporation ran a summer programme of events to promote these parks to its new and growing population.

Document #36 is a scrapbook created by the Principal Local Recreation Promotion and Development Officer, working at Milton Keynes Development Corporation, containing posters of the “Enjoy your Local Parks, 1984” campaign, as well as photographs of many of the events held.

Events included a Circus Workshop with Rainbow Theatre at Fishermead; parachute games at Beanhill; a performance by the Great Horwood Silver Band at Fishermead; Hot Air Balloon ascents with local balloonist Fred Willmer at Fullers Slade and Kite Making Day at Furzton. Below is a picture of one of the more unusual events:  a facilitated play put on by local children called The Ballad of the Beggars, at Netherfield.
